“I Have No Doubt” — Anita Among Breaks Silence After Oboth and Tayebwa Speakership Win
Former Speaker of Parliament Anita Among has publicly congratulated Jacob Marksons Oboth-Oboth and Thomas Tayebwa following their election as Speaker and Deputy Speaker of Uganda’s 12th Parliament, marking her first major public reaction to the leadership transition at the House.
In a brief statement shared after Monday’s heated but orderly vote at Kololo Ceremonial Grounds, Among praised the two leaders, expressing confidence in their ability to steer Parliament’s legislative agenda during the new term.
